# CPF — how to use (mcp.ai)

Valida CPF (dígitos verificadores) e descobre processos judiciais por CPF — buscando por NOME no Diário (DJEN). Importante: CPF→nome não é dado público; informe o nome do titular (recomendado). Sem credencial.

## Option A — via MCP (recommended)
Remote MCP endpoint (HTTP, streamable): `https://api.mcp.ai/p_cpf?ms=1781044440000`
Add it as a custom/remote MCP connector in your client (Claude, Cursor, VS Code…), then authenticate when prompted. Once connected, ask the agent to use the server's tools (e.g. `cpf_processos`).

## Option B — via direct REST API
Base URL: `https://api.mcp.ai/api/cpf`
Auth: `Authorization: Bearer sk_live_…` — create a workspace API key at https://mcp.ai/settings/api-keys
Discover endpoints: `GET https://api.mcp.ai/api/cpf/_endpoints`

### Endpoints
- `POST https://api.mcp.ai/api/cpf/processos` — DESCOBERTA por CPF: busca os processos da pessoa por NOME no Diário (DJEN), grátis. IMPORTANTE: CPF→nome não é dado público — informe o parâmetro `nome` (recomendado). Sem nome, só resolve se houver u
  - body: { cpf: string, nome?: string }
- `POST https://api.mcp.ai/api/cpf/validar` — Valida os dígitos verificadores de um CPF (mod 11) e informa se há broker de identidade disponível. Não revela a identidade do titular.
  - body: { cpf: string }

## Example prompts
- "Valide o CPF 000.000.000-00"
- "Processos do CPF 000.000.000-00 (nome: João da Silva)"
- "Esse CPF é válido?"

## More
- Page: https://mcp.ai/cpf
- Agent spec (llms.txt): https://mcp.ai/cpf/llms.txt
- Postman collection: https://mcp.ai/cpf/postman.json
